Output b84fba5000b61eaa4037edd8df25c122afc8f250179d5d9d610321c02d4311d4:68
- value
- 3020252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24a24dd77b6e030d8decb0f7b7471c3fa6d5378a OP_EQUAL
- address
- 352igXvuDgbGUbHYDenWU5m5ra2rwh3MjE
- transaction
- b84fba5000b61eaa4037edd8df25c122afc8f250179d5d9d610321c02d4311d4